What You Will Need
Before starting your pampas grass wall project, gather the following materials:
Materials | Quantity |
---|---|
Dried pampas grass stems | 10-15 stems |
Floral wire or twine | 1 roll |
Wooden dowel or branch | 1 piece |
Hot glue gun | 1 |
Scissors | 1 pair |
Optional: Paint or stain for wooden dowel | 1 bottle |
Step-by-Step Guide to Creating Your Pampas Grass Wall Accent
Step 1: Prepare the Dried Pampas Grass
Begin by trimming your pampas grass stems to your desired length. Typically, stems between 2 to 4 feet long are ideal for wall decor. Ensure all stems are similar in height for a cohesive look.
Step 2: Attach the Stems to the Wooden Dowel
Using floral wire or twine, securely bundle the stems together and attach them to the wooden dowel or branch. Space the stems evenly, allowing some to hang lower for a natural look. Make sure each stem is firm but not overly tight, which could damage them.
Step 3: Secure with Hot Glue
If you want extra stability, apply a small amount of hot glue to the base of each stem where it meets the dowel. This will help keep the stems in place while also enhancing the overall appearance.
Step 4: Paint or Stain the Dowel (Optional)
If desired, now is the time to customize your wooden dowel or branch. Use paint or stain to complement your decor style. Allow it to dry thoroughly before proceeding.
Step 5: Hang Your Beautiful Wall Accent
Find the perfect spot on your wall to hang your new pampas grass accent. Use wall hooks or nails to securely hold the dowel. Stand back and admire the beautiful texture and visual interest it adds to your space.

Maintaining Your Pampas Grass Wall Decor
Pampas grass requires minimal maintenance, but here are a few tips to keep it looking its best:
- Keep away from direct sunlight to prevent fading.
- Gently dust the stems every few weeks.
- Replace any stems that may become damaged or discolored.
